MSP430 Touchscreen Piano

[Rohit Gupta] a scris pentru a împărtăși acest proiect touchscreen Piano Proiect pe care la construit în jurul TI Launchpad. A oferit o modalitate de a verifica utilizând un digitizator rezistiv descoperit pe o mulțime de dispozitive mobile. Acestea sunt pur și simplu blocate la partea de sus a ecranelor LCD, precum și înlocuirea sunt ieftine, cu toate acestea, salvarea unuia de la hardware-ul vechi este o opțiune.

Primul lucru pe care la făcut a fost să testeze cele patru ieșiri ale digitizatorului cu multimetrul său. Înregistrarea rezistenței de modificare vă va ajuta să vă asigurați că citiți firele corespunzătoare, precum și să puteți zero în setări înainte de a începe codarea. [RoHit] utilizează ADC pe cipul MSP430 pentru a citi de pe ecran. El a mers cu algoritmul dintr-una din notele de aplicație ale lui TI pentru a converti citirile în X, precum și coordonatele Y.

El a separat ecranul în șapte coloane, fiecare generând un ton diferit. Atingerea mai mare sau mai mică pe această coloană va schimba pitch-ul nota produsă. Puteți auzi un exemplu de acest lucru în demo după salt.

Share this post

Leave a Reply

Your email address will not be published. Required fields are marked *